        How to Withdraw from Binance Exchange: A Step-by-Step Guide for Crypto Users


        Binance is one of the largest and most widely used cryptocurrency exchanges in the world. Many new users often ask, "Is Binance an exchange?" The answer is yes—Binance is a centralized exchange that allows users to buy, sell, and trade a vast range of digital assets. However, once you have assets on Binance, the next logical question is: "How do I withdraw from Binance?" Understanding the withdrawal process is essential for anyone who wants to move their crypto to a personal wallet or a different platform.

        First, it is important to confirm that you have a verified Binance account. Withdrawal functionality is only available after completing identity verification. To start withdrawing, log into your Binance account and navigate to the "Wallet" section. From there, select "Withdraw." You will then choose the cryptocurrency you wish to withdraw—Bitcoin, Ethereum, USDT, or any other supported coin.

        Next, you must enter the withdrawal address. This is the public address of your external wallet. Be extremely careful here: cryptocurrency transactions are irreversible. A single incorrect character in the address could result in permanent loss of funds. Many users prefer to scan a QR code or copy-paste the address directly from their wallet to avoid typos.

        After entering the address, specify the amount you want to withdraw. Binance will display the network fee and the minimum withdrawal limit for that specific coin. Some assets, like Ethereum or BSC-based tokens, allow you to choose a network type. Always ensure that the network you select matches the network of your receiving wallet. For example, if your wallet supports only the BEP-20 network, do not choose ERC-20, or your funds may be lost.

        Once you confirm the details, Binance will send a verification code to your email and/or phone number. Enter this code to proceed. Depending on your security settings, you may also need to complete two-factor authentication. Finally, click "Submit." The withdrawal will be processed, and you can track its status under the "Transaction History" section. Blockchain confirmations may take a few minutes to several hours, depending on network congestion.
